- br0ck, on 01/15/2008, -1/+18He's not talking about the Netflix DVD service, he's talking about the Netflix download service which allows unlimited PC viewing of 6000 titles. The field is actually growing crowded with Blockbuster and Best Buy launching a competitor, XBox Live allowing SD&HD downloads, Amazon's Unbox available on Tivos, and some cable companies offer a wide selection of SD&HD movie downloads.
